dc.description.abstract | A simplified determination method of vertical contact forces is created, which allows determining the forces occurring in the contact between wheel and rail, without the mathematical modelling. The contact between wheel and rail is considered as the interaction of two flat bodies. We obtain the summary contact force, by knowing the contact impact force and static wheel load. A possibility, to quickly determine the force occurring in the contact and to predict its impact on the rail, wheel it is bearings and etc. appears. Maximum force values obtained by using this method have been compared with the values obtained using VACD subsystem Atlas – LG. | en_US |
